The Tomb of Ali Mardan Khan

 The Tomb of Ali Mardan Khan 


THE GRAND TOMB OF ALI MARDAN Khan has represented a very long time as an exquisite internment structure. And keeping in mind that it was once encircled by a rich nursery, it is currently encircled by mechanical rail yards and is just open by means of a long restricted back street



Initially worked around the 1650s, the burial place holds the remaining parts of Ali Mardan Khan, a previous senator in the locale. Before being covered in his beautiful, octagonal burial chamber, Khan represented the regions of Kashmir, Lahore and Kabul in the mid-1600s. The enormous block burial chamber had really been set up for Khan's mom, yet when he passed on in 1657, and was covered neighboring her inside, the burial chamber came to tolerate his name. At the hour of its development, it likely remained in a lavishly gone to heaven garden, in the same way as other comparative burial chambers. 

In its unique structure, the burial chamber was likely canvassed in bright embellishment, however time has negatively affected the burial place, and the outside is currently a uniform block shading that gives a false representation of its development. In any case, the famous vault on head of the structure. also, it's ornamental segments despite everything stand. Indeed, even inside, the real burial chamber, which lays subterranean level, is regularly encircled by contributions left by guests. Neighborhood talk has it that Khan was viewed as a blessed man, and many allude to the burial place as his holy place. 

Today, the nursery is a distant memory, and the site of the notable burial place is encircled on all sides by railroad yards. So as to keep individuals out of the yards, yet at the same time permit access to the burial place, a very nearly 1000 foot long way was made out of whole block dividers that encase a restricted back street way. While it appears to be a dreary access to such a great burial place, it figures out how to make really showing up at the site even more amazing.
